[][src]Struct futures::io::AllowStdIo

pub struct AllowStdIo<T>(_);
[]

A simple wrapper type which allows types which implement only implement std::io::Read or std::io::Write to be used in contexts which expect an AsyncRead or AsyncWrite.

If these types issue an error with the kind io::ErrorKind::WouldBlock, it is expected that they will notify the current task on readiness. Synchronous std types should not issue errors of this kind and are safe to use in this context. However, using these types with AllowStdIo will cause the event loop to block, so they should be used with care.

Methods

impl<T> AllowStdIo<T>[src][]

Creates a new AllowStdIo from an existing IO object.

Returns a reference to the contained IO object.

Returns a mutable reference to the contained IO object.

Consumes self and returns the contained IO object.
